1. Auto Repair Tutorials
  2. Diagnostics Tutorials
  3. Troubleshooting engine problems with diagnostics software

Troubleshooting Engine Problems with Diagnostic Software

Learn how to use diagnostic software to troubleshoot engine problems with this comprehensive tutorial.

Troubleshooting Engine Problems with Diagnostic Software

When it comes to troubleshooting engine problems, diagnostic software is an invaluable tool. It can help pinpoint the cause of an issue quickly and accurately, saving time and money. In this article, we'll explore how diagnostic software works, how to use it to diagnose engine problems, and why it's an essential part of any auto repair shop or DIY garage. We'll look at the different types of diagnostic software available, the benefits they offer, and how to select the right one for your needs.

We'll also examine how to interpret data generated by the software and how to use it to make informed decisions about engine repairs. Finally, we'll discuss the importance of staying up to date on the latest software updates and how to ensure that your diagnostic tools are always working optimally. Diagnostic software is an invaluable tool for troubleshooting engine problems. There are several different types of diagnostic software available, such as OBD-II and CAN bus scanners. Each type of scanner has its own unique capabilities and can be used to identify and fix a range of engine problems.

OBD-II scanners are the most commonly used type of diagnostic software. These scanners are designed to read and interpret data from the engine's On Board Diagnostics (OBD) system, which can provide insight into potential engine problems. Common engine problems that can be identified with OBD-II scanners include misfires, faulty sensors, and emissions issues. CAN bus scanners are also used to diagnose engine problems.

CAN bus scanners are designed to read and interpret data from the vehicle's CAN bus system, which is a network of communication lines used to control various systems in the car. With a CAN bus scanner, you can identify faults in the engine control module (ECM), transmission control module (TCM), and other vehicle systems. When using diagnostic software to troubleshoot engine problems, it is important to understand how to interpret the data provided by the scanner. Depending on the type of scanner being used, you may be able to identify specific engine problems based on the data provided.

For example, some OBD-II scanners can detect misfire codes that indicate a faulty spark plug or ignition coil. Other scanners may also provide information about emissions levels, fuel economy, and other performance metrics. In addition to identifying engine problems, diagnostic software can also be used to reset engine codes and calibrate the engine. This is done by connecting the scanner to the vehicle's OBD port and using the appropriate software commands.

Resetting codes can often fix common engine problems without requiring any additional repairs or replacements. Additionally, calibrating the engine can help ensure that it runs optimally and increases fuel efficiency. Using diagnostic software to troubleshoot engine problems requires knowledge of how the different types of scanners work and how to interpret their data. Depending on the type of problem being diagnosed, different types of software may be more suitable than others.

For instance, OBD-II scanners are best suited for diagnosing misfires and emissions issues, while CAN bus scanners are better for diagnosing faults in the ECM or TCM. It is important to understand how each type of scanner works and how to interpret its data in order to get the most out of it. Diagnostic software can be a great tool for identifying and fixing engine problems quickly and efficiently. With the right knowledge and tools, you can use diagnostic software to diagnose and fix common engine issues with ease.

Interpreting Diagnostic Data

When troubleshooting engine problems, it is important to interpret the data from diagnostic scans correctly. Diagnostic scans provide a wealth of information that can be used to identify and fix engine problems.

This includes information about the engine’s performance, as well as any fault codes or error messages that may indicate a problem with the engine. When interpreting diagnostic data, it is important to understand what the data means. Fault codes and error messages are specific to each vehicle, so it is important to research the codes and messages in order to understand what they indicate. For example, a fault code for an oxygen sensor may indicate a faulty sensor or a problem with the fuel system. It is also important to consider other factors when interpreting diagnostic data. For example, if the engine is running rough or misfiring, other potential causes should be considered in addition to any fault codes or error messages. Using diagnostic software to interpret diagnostic data can be very helpful in diagnosing and fixing engine problems.

By understanding how to correctly interpret diagnostic data, you will be able to quickly and accurately diagnose and repair engine problems.

What is Diagnostic Software?

Diagnostic software is a computer program that helps mechanics and technicians diagnose engine problems. It utilizes a range of scanners, such as OBD-II and CAN bus scanners, to detect and identify engine codes, allowing technicians to quickly locate and repair issues. OBD-II scanners are the most commonly used type of scanner for troubleshooting engine problems. It connects to the vehicle's onboard computer system and retrieves data from it, such as engine temperature, fuel efficiency, and diagnostic trouble codes.

OBD-II scanners are capable of reading both generic and manufacturer-specific diagnostic trouble codes. CAN bus scanners are more advanced than OBD-II scanners, as they are able to read and interpret data from multiple systems on the vehicle, such as the engine control unit and ABS. CAN bus scanners can detect and diagnose issues related to the air conditioning system, transmission control module, and other vehicle systems. By utilizing these scanners, technicians can quickly identify the source of engine problems and develop a plan of action for repairs.

Diagnostic software allows mechanics and technicians to diagnose engine problems quickly and efficiently.

Resetting Engine Codes

Diagnostic software can be used to reset engine codes and calibrate the engine. This is essential for maintaining the performance of your vehicle. To reset an engine code, you need to use the diagnostic software to identify the code and then reset it. The calibration process involves adjusting the fuel-air mixture and the ignition timing.

This is done by adjusting the engine's sensors and components to their optimal levels. When resetting an engine code, it is important to follow the instructions provided by the diagnostic software and adhere to the manufacturer's guidelines. If done correctly, this can save time and money by avoiding costly repairs that may not be necessary. Also, it is important to make sure that all components are in good working order before attempting any calibrations. Once an engine code has been reset, it is important to keep track of it in order to monitor any changes. This is important because if there is a sudden change in the code, it could indicate a problem with the engine or its components.

If this happens, it is essential to get professional help in order to diagnose and fix the problem.

Common Engine Problems

When it comes to troubleshooting engine problems, there are a few common issues that can be easily identified and fixed using diagnostic software. One of the most common issues is a faulty spark plug. Diagnostic software can detect when a spark plug is not functioning correctly and can recommend a replacement. Another common problem is a faulty oxygen sensor.

Diagnostic software can detect when an oxygen sensor is malfunctioning and can suggest a replacement. Diagnostic software can also be used to diagnose problems with an engine's fuel injection system. This includes detecting issues with fuel injectors, fuel pressure regulators, and fuel filters. Diagnostic software can detect when these components are not functioning correctly and can recommend a replacement. It can also be used to detect problems with the engine's ignition system, such as a faulty distributor or spark plug wires.

Using diagnostic software can help identify and fix many other engine problems as well. For example, it can be used to identify issues with the engine's oil pressure, oil levels, or coolant levels. It can also detect problems with the engine's timing belt, camshaft, or valves. Diagnostic software can be invaluable when it comes to identifying and fixing engine problems quickly and efficiently.

Using Different Types of Diagnostic Software

When it comes to troubleshooting engine problems, diagnostic software can be invaluable.

Different types of diagnostic software can be used in different scenarios, depending on the type and complexity of the issue. Here are some examples of how different types of diagnostic software can be used:Code Scanners - Code scanners are simple and easy to use diagnostic tools that can be plugged into the vehicle's OBD-II port. They can quickly detect and read trouble codes, which will provide a starting point for further diagnosis. Some code scanners also have additional features such as the ability to reset check engine lights and clear codes from the system.

Factory Software

- Many vehicle manufacturers offer their own proprietary diagnostic software programs.

These programs offer more detailed information than code scanners, as they often include data on specific components and systems of the vehicle. They may also include reset procedures and other special functions.

Third-Party Software

- Third-party diagnostic software programs are available for most vehicles. These programs are often similar to factory software but may offer additional features such as remote access and more comprehensive data logging. They may also include comprehensive repair information, wiring diagrams, and other helpful information.

On-Board Diagnostics (OBD)

- Many vehicles are now equipped with an On-Board Diagnostics (OBD) system.

This system records data such as engine speed, fuel level, and temperature, which can be used to diagnose a variety of engine problems. OBD diagnostics can also detect when a component has failed or needs to be replaced. By using the right type of diagnostic software, you can quickly identify and fix engine problems without having to guess or go through extensive troubleshooting procedures. With these tools, you can save time and money while ensuring that your vehicle is running smoothly. This tutorial has outlined the various ways in which diagnostic software can be used to identify and fix engine problems. Diagnostic software can provide an invaluable tool for troubleshooting engine problems, as it allows users to quickly and accurately diagnose issues.

However, it is important to understand how to interpret the data from a diagnostic scan in order to correctly diagnose and fix engine problems. With the right tools and knowledge, diagnosing engine problems can be a relatively straightforward task.